Angel Links is about a 16 year old girl, Meifon Li, who becomes the head of a corporation dedicated to saving transportation companies in outer space from pirates for free, as per her grandfather's dying wish. Characters

Meifon Li
Central protagonist of the anime and leader of the pirate-fighting service known as Angel Links. She is an excited and romantic teenager who takes her job seriously, but shows a relaxed side when she's not on duty.
Meifon's most noteworthy trait is her large bust, and is often the subject of fanservice because of it. Her partner in battle is Taffei, who hides in her bust until Meifon calls for his help (Taffei transforms into a unique blade that has the visual qualities of angelic and demonic).
Meifon excels at both martial arts and swordsmanship. She also has a hotblooded side to her, and like Duuz she enjoys a good fight. Meifon is plagued with a strange past that unveils itself as the anime moves forward.

Kosei Hida
Meifon's left-hand man and the one in charge of various departments such as the payroll for the company. On ship, he usually takes a passive role as Meifon's advisor. He also prepares tea occasionally during a relatively minor battle.
Kosei originally served Meifon's grandfather Chenho Li, which explains his willingness to always assist Meifon. Generally a well-mannered young man who is popular with women because of his attractive appearance, Kosei strives to do everything in a just and timely method. When it comes to battle, Kosei does not show much participation, but has some skill with a number of firearms. She used to be a tactician for the Einhorn Empire and was their top strategist despite being so young at the time, but was put on trial for disobeying orders and getting most of her fleet killed during one mission. She also had a lover named Lawrence during her time in Einhorn, but had to drop the relationship when she was exiled. When Meifon is not present on the ship, Valeria assumes role as commander.
In actual combat, Valeria wields tonfa with amazing skill as well as kickboxing (which she also trains in when she is off duty). In contrast to her Outlaw Star appearance, the major differences are her hair (which is far more wild-looking, including a more defined red streak which can only be seen in her final scene in "Law and Lawlessness" and on the opposite side) and her personality (which is more relaxed in comparison to being so "by-the-book" in Outlaw Star). She is also the only character among the crew who could be considered Duuz's friend, out of respect for one another's battle talents and perhaps because they are closer in age than the other crew members, who are teenagers to young adults.

Duuz is the ship's Platoon Commander.
Known for being the most powerful among his people (called Dragonites in Angel Links rather than Saurians), he is unmatched in swordsmanship and barehanded combat. Highly powerful and deadly, Duuz fights battles alone (though he is assisted by Meifon, Kosei and Valeria occasionally) and never seems to suffer any kind of damage. He is so skilled that he can deflect bullets with his sword. Incidentally, like Valeria, he is often the most calm member of the entire crew, silently polishing his cherished sword. He is also wise and contemplative, and is able to read the enemies' moves with little trouble as well as give advice "like a wise old dragon".
Duuz is a vegetarian, which is difficult to believe since his muscular build is quite large for someone who subsisted on vegetables his whole life, and does not like seafood. In regards to his appearance, he has different coloring for his scales and his eyes, and a tail more like a crocodile's.
In Outlaw Star it was stated his species was genetically engineered from dinosaurs. In Angel Links, Dragonites are their own people (a naturally born race rather than a created one).
